Electro Funk

Electro-Funk is undoubtedly the most misunderstood of all UK Dance genres, yet probably the most vital with regards to its overall influence.

What was all the fuss with Darren Emerson

In short: Darren Emerson was once subscribed to UKD. Tomato are heavily linked with Underworld. Tomato made an advert for the Telegraph, which used an Underworld tune.
